No sign of aircraft in second Nepalese quake

The Himalayan nation is still reeling from last month’s quake measuring a magnitude of 7.8 that killed more than 8,000 people and injured close to 20,000. Tuesday’s 7.3 quake has killed 67 people and destroyed many houses.
The US helicopter was delivering aid in Dolakha, one of the districts hit hardest by both quakes, when it went missing with six Marines and two Nepali troops on board.
